Dr. Fathi bin Shataan confirmed that the outputs of the 4+4 Committee faced widespread popular rejection across both eastern and western Libya, and that they go against the will of the people, according to his statement to "Ain Libya" network. He considered that the presence of the Parliament and the State Council does not justify the continued existence of the two corrupt governments. He stated that the dream of unifying the army is impossible unless one side takes control. He pointed out that eliminating corruption is unfeasible as long as two governments share the resources, and that elections will be postponed indefinitely. He warned that the United Nations is working against the interests of the Libyan people, and that its continued involvement may threaten the country.
